Parsley is a perennial herbaceous plant belonging to the genus of biennials in the Apiaceae family. The native land of parsley is considered to be the island of Sardinia, and the first mentions of it can be found in ancient Egyptian papyri. In the wild, parsley grows along the coast of the Mediterranean Sea, and in culture it is cultivated in various regions, including northern USA, southern Canada, and all of continental Europe. The plant is cold-hardy, not demanding in moisture, but requires good lighting. Parsley grows well on most soil types, except for excessively wet and dry sandy soils. Parsley leaves are dark green and shiny, the stem is strongly branched and smooth. The root system consists of a main and lateral roots, and flowers are collected in umbels. Fruits represent small two-seeded fruits. In cooking, parsley is valued for its taste qualities and used as a spicy herb. For seasoning, both leaves and root vegetables are applied. Parsley is consumed fresh, dried, and salted, adding it to salads, sides, and soups.
